We made every attempt to capture all applicable sections of the 2010 … WebA hearing loop (AKA an audio induction loop or telecoil system) is an assistive listening system for use in an auditorium where conference participants with hearing aids that have ’T-coils’ are automatically ‘tuned in’. The sound is transmitted to the listeners through a cable that runs around the perimeter of the coverage area.
